Capacity note for the Bramblewick export retry queue. Failed exports are requeued with exponential backoff, and the queue depth is our main capacity signal: sustained depth above the high-water mark means downstream Pellis storage is saturated, not that we need more workers. As the new contractor, please don't raise worker counts without checking storage latency first — it usually makes things worse. Retry timing, backoff caps, and the high-water threshold are all driven by the constants shown below.

limits module of yagef-bajog:
TIERS = {
    "druael": 370,
    "tamix": 286,
    "pelius": 541,
    "pelael": 78,
    "pelox": 47,
    "ralath": 533,
    "drumir": 801,
}

Ticket: Vault locked — Ostwhile migrations pipeline blocked. The zero-downtime migration for release 9.4 (expand/contract on the orders table) can't proceed because the credentials vault sealed itself after last night's host reboot. Backfill job is paused mid-expand; do not run contract steps until it resumes. No data risk, but the release window shrinks every hour we wait. Release manager: approve emergency unseal so we can restart the runner. The vault accepts the recovery passphrase below.

unlock words, yawig-kagef: gordor-holvan-ulaael-pramir-ulaiel-tamdor

### Runbook: BounceBroom — Account Recovery

If the BounceBroom email bounce processor loses access to its service account, do not create a new one. First, pause the intake queue so bounces buffer safely. Then open the recovery console and select the BounceBroom principal. Verification requires approval from the on-call lead. Once approved, the console prompts for the stored recovery credentials; enter the passphrase that appears directly below this paragraph.

recovery phrase for fahof-kahap: holion-gormir-jorix-istix-briwyn-sorael

## Environment Variables — Spokeshift Rebalancer

Most knobs are safe to tweak mid-shift: truck capacity, station weights, polling interval. The solver restarts cleanly on change. Don't touch the fleet region code unless dispatch asks. The rebalancer also needs its dispatch API credential, which lives in the env file immediately after this line.

vault entry, yahif-yajep: COURIER_KEY29=b802bdf8034096b65a51c6ba5abe2